## Configuration — blue-green deploys

The Ledgerpost billing worker reads all config from env files baked per color. BLUEGREEN_COLOR identifies the slot; DRAIN_TIMEOUT_SECONDS controls cutover grace (default 120). Both files must stay byte-identical except for the color var — reviewers should diff them on every change. Each file ends with the payment-gateway credential for that slot, placed on the line directly after this one:

sealed setting: ARCHIVE_KEY3=8d0

Subject: Assigner cut-over — done

Hey, quick wrap-up before your shift: we finished moving the Lanternquay assignment service onto the new bucketing engine at 14:30. Traffic is fully on the replacement, old pods are scaled to zero, and experiment allocations look stable. If anything drifts overnight, roll back via the Fernwick toggle — no redeploy needed. For reference during your shift, the live configuration now in effect is as follows.

settings of tagef-bawif:
DRUIX_HOST=druix.zemvarlabs.internal
DRUIX_PORT=8000

**Q: What happens if the GreenTick watering scheduler loses its configuration after a power outage?**

A: GreenTick stores its watering schedule in local flash, which can occasionally corrupt after abrupt power loss. As a contractor, your first step is to reboot the hub and check whether zones reappear. If the hub prompts for restoration instead, it requires the recovery passphrase before it will reload the saved schedule. That passphrase is recorded immediately below this entry.

unlock words, hahip-baduf: holwyn-istath-julvan